Understanding common legal terms can help clients better navigate their boating accident claims. Below are definitions of key concepts frequently encountered during the legal process.
Liability refers to the legal responsibility for causing harm or damages in an accident. Establishing liability is essential in boating accident cases to determine who is accountable for injuries or losses.
Negligence occurs when a party fails to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to others. Proving negligence is key to prevailing in most boating accident claims.
Damages are the monetary compensation sought for losses suffered due to the accident, including med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.
Maritime law, or admiralty law, governs legal issues related to navigable waters and vessels. It includes specific rules and regulations that apply to boating accident cases.

After a boating accident, ensure everyone’s safety and call emergency services if necessary. Document the scene with photos and gather witness information. Seeking medical attention promptly is important even if injuries do not seem severe. Contacting a boating accident attorney early can help protect your rights and guide you through the claims process.
Fault is determined by investigating the circumstances of the accident, including reviewing boating safety rules, operator conduct, and evidence from the scene. Liability may involve one or more parties depending on negligence or violations of maritime laws. An attorney can help establish fault to support your claim for compensation.
Compensation may include med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, property damage, and in some cases, punitive damages. Each claim is unique, and an attorney can help quantify all applicable damages to ensure you seek full recovery.
Not all boating accident claims require a lawsuit. Many cases settle through negotiation with insurance companies. However, if a fair settlement cannot be reached, filing a lawsuit may be necessary to protect your rights. An attorney can advise on the best course of action based on your case.
In New York, personal injury claims generally must be filed within three years of the accident date. Specific maritime cases may have different deadlines. It is important to consult with an attorney promptly to ensure your claim is filed within the applicable statute of limitations.
New York follows a comparative negligence rule, which means you may still recover damages even if you share some fault. Your compensation may be reduced by your percentage of fault. An attorney can help assess your case and negotiate accordingly.
Claims against uninsured parties can be more challenging but not impossible. Your attorney can explore alternative compensation options, including your own insurance policies, and pursue legal remedies to protect your interests.
Many boating accident att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ay no upfront costs and fees are only charged if you recover compensation. This arrangement allows clients to access legal representation without financial stress.
Some boating accident cases settle before trial, but others may require court proceedings to resolve disputes. Your attorney will discuss your options and prepare to represent you effectively whether in negotiation or trial.
The duration of a boating accident claim depends on case complexity, insurance negotiations, and whether litigation is necessary. Some claims resolve in a few months, while others may take longer. Your attorney will keep you informed throughout the process.
